A typical factor people work with a Sutherland Shire Level 2 Electrician is to handle concerns connected to customer mains, such as setup, repair, or upgrades. Customer mains are essential cables that link your home to the main switchboard, and in time, they may become too little or damaged due to the increased power needs of contemporary appliances. Regular electricians are not permitted to deal with consumer mains; only Accredited Company (ASPs) have the permission to safely handle the high-voltage tasks of disconnecting and reconnecting the power supply. Upgrading customer mains typically includes the switch from a single-phase to a three-phase power supply, a substantial job that enhances a residential or commercial property's electrical capability, which is commonly required in the Sutherland Shire area of Sydney.
Sutherland Shire Level 2 Electricians of work is divided into distinct expert classifications, as defined by regulatory authorities. The 2A category allows them to disconnect and reconnect power at the main connection point. The 2B category encompasses underground electrical work, for consumer mains. Class 2C focuses on overhead electrical services, including maintenance and repairs of powerlines, require making use of aerial lifts. Class 2D accreditation allows for the wise meters and supporting infrastructure for renewable energy rewards. A Sutherland Shire Level 2 Electrician with all 4 categories can effectively deal with the diverse electrical requirements of residential or commercial properties, despite whether they get power through overhead lines or underground cabling.
A Level 2 Electrician in Sutherland Shire plays a crucial function in repairing flaw network service providers. These notices are provided when a property's electrical setup is deemed unsafe or not up to code, often due to concerns like damaged power poles or faulty accessories. It is vital to resolve these flaws immediately as overlooking them can result in a power disconnection for security reasons. A qualified ASP Level 2 electrician has the required abilities and permission to correct these issues effectively. With a deep understanding of regional network policies, the electrician can swiftly fix the problems, guaranteeing the property meets safety requirements and avoiding extended power interruptions.
Sutherland Shire Level 2 Electricians are accountable for handling personal power pole setups and replacements. Private power poles are important for residential or commercial properties with specific gain access to requires or bigger blocks, as they bring electrical power from the street network to the structure. When these poles are damaged by storms, age, or accidents, a Level 2 ASP should de-energise the location, install a new pole (whether lumber or galvanised steel), and restore the power connection. This task is elaborate and essential for safety, highlighting the specific nature of their license.
